Mahomet-Seymour Sophomore Trio Qualifies for Freshman-Sophomore State Wrestling Tournament

By FRED KRONER fred@mahometnews.com Mahomet-Seymour wrestlers Noah Frank, Noah Daniels and Phil Daniels all qualified for the Illinois Wrestling Coaches and Officials Association Freshman-Sophomore state tournament. All three are sophomores. In a sectional tournament held at Heyworth on Sunday (March 3), Frank and Noah Daniels both won their weight classes. […]

Mahomet-Seymour Junior High Wrestlers Dominate Sectionals, Seven Advance to State Tournament

By FRED KRONER fred@mahometnews.com Seven Mahomet-Seymour Junior High wrestlers qualified for the IESA state tournament based on their performances on Saturday (March 2) in a 23-school sectional meet at Jacksonville. M-S volleyball seventh-graders win once at regional before being eliminated

Mahomet-Seymour’s Junior High seventh-grade volleyball team snapped a five-match losing streak on Monday (Feb. 26) with an IESA Class 4A regional quarterfinal victory over Danville North Ridge, 25-12, 25-18, at Champaign Edison. M-S 1600-m time currently first in state

By Fred Kroner Mahomet-Seymour’s veteran 1,600-meter relay foursome won top honors on Saturday (Feb. 24) at the Coach Basting indoor boys’ track and field meet at Illinois Wesleyan University, in Bloomington.
